And the LORD spake unto Moses and unto Aaron, saying,(Levítico 14:33)
When ye be come into the land of Canaan, which I give to you for a possession, and I put the plague of leprosy in a house of the land of your possession;(Levítico 14:34)
And he that owneth the house shall come and tell the priest, saying, It seemeth to me there is as it were a plague in the house:
Then the priest shall command that they empty the house, before the priest go into it to see the plague, that all that is in the house be not made unclean: and afterward the priest shall go in to see the house:(Levítico 14:36)
And he shall look on the plague, and, behold, if the plague be in the walls of the house with hollow streaks, greenish or reddish, which in sight are lower than the wall;(Levítico 14:37)
Then the priest shall go out of the house to the door of the house, and shut up the house seven days:(Levítico 14:38)
